Output 3ecdbbb5d4873c1552effd8ce31bd2d1865e4807353dc192f2e9851f1bb9943d:3

value
33186033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66da2de123730c834237977bc7ec08d4d08c0392 OP_EQUAL
address
MHGzXMXCTGkgGsfHdzfPk74jktWwYWBGhM
transaction
3ecdbbb5d4873c1552effd8ce31bd2d1865e4807353dc192f2e9851f1bb9943d
spent
true